Development of policies and the degree of alignment of North Macedonia’s legislation with the EU acquis in the sector of fisheries will be in the focus of the agenda of the bilateral screening meeting for Chapter 13 (Fisheries) taking place on Thursday and Friday in Brussels.
As Deputy PM for European Affairs Bojan Maricic said, with the achievement of the Chapter’s standards, the country will be able to get money from the structural funds of the EU intended for fisheries.
In the frames of his visit to Brussels, Maricic was part of Global Gateway Forum, where he delivered an address at the leaders’ session on education and research.
Maricic also met European Commission representatives. Developments related to North Macedonia’s path were the main topics of discussion. The Deputy PM also held a briefing meeting with delegates from the Working Party on Enlargement and Countries Negotiating Accession to the EU.
